Output fda7273163a6f3bc7e0f5401b3330a27b637bcc6271fb494a8868713fef12229:0

value
9950000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f374e8f35e80b945fb6587a3f1e7cbdb8b7c27 OP_EQUAL
address
3BMEXMQP27DxZjgJQgBF3gPjA8acyJa3gG
transaction
fda7273163a6f3bc7e0f5401b3330a27b637bcc6271fb494a8868713fef12229
spent
true